The Campark T85 is a 20MP/1296P WiFi and Bluetooth trail camera with a fast 0.3-second trigger speed and no-glow infrared, aimed at serious wildlife monitoring and hunting scouting. Here’s a complete setup walkthrough covering the details that matter most for a smooth first deployment.

Key Specs
- Photo resolution: 24MP, 16MP, 12MP, 8MP, or 5MP options
- Video resolution: 1296P (1728×1296, 30fps) or 1080P (1920×1080, 30fps)
- Sensor: 20-megapixel CMOS
- Trigger speed: 0.3 seconds
- Detection range: 65ft with a wide detection angle
- Infrared: 36-piece no-glow flash, 65ft range
- Waterproofing: IP66 rated housing
- Connectivity: WiFi and Bluetooth via “Trail Camera Pro” (iOS) or “Trail Camera Pro 2” (Android)
Step 1: Battery Selection
The T85 accepts either 4 or 8 AA batteries, with Campark recommending 1.5V alkaline as a baseline but specifically suggesting Energizer Ultimate Lithium batteries for longer battery life and better cold-weather performance. For extended deployments, particularly in colder climates, the extra cost of lithium batteries is generally worth it, since alkaline batteries lose capacity more significantly in low temperatures.
Step 2: Insert and Format the MicroSD Card
The T85 accepts cards up to 128GB, well beyond the 32GB many buyers assume based on older trail camera standards. Format the card in-camera before first use, even if it’s brand new, to avoid the file system compatibility issues that affect trail cameras generally when cards are formatted only on a computer.
Step 3: Connect via Bluetooth and WiFi
Download the appropriate app for your device — “Trail Camera Pro” for iOS or “Trail Camera Pro 2” for Android — and use Bluetooth to toggle the camera’s WiFi on and off without needing a physical remote control. This two-step connectivity approach (Bluetooth for basic control, WiFi for full app access) is a genuinely convenient design, letting you save battery by keeping WiFi off until you specifically need full app functionality.

Step 4: Mount Using the Included Tripod and Strap
The T85 includes both a threaded tripod mount and a mounting strap, giving flexibility for either a tree-mounted setup using the strap or a tripod-based setup for locations without a suitable tree, like open fields or food plots. Secure the mount firmly to avoid wind-triggered false captures, and angle the camera toward the expected animal travel path rather than perfectly perpendicular to it for the most natural framing.
Step 5: Choose Resolution Based on Your Goal
With five photo resolution tiers available, matching your choice to your actual monitoring goal matters — full 24MP for situations where identifying specific individual animals matters, a mid-tier setting like 12MP for general scouting where storage efficiency matters more, and video at 1296P if you specifically want to observe behavior over still images alone.
Step 6: Test Before Leaving It Unattended
Before walking away from a fresh setup, trigger a test capture (walking in front of the sensor works) and review it through the app or on-camera screen to confirm framing, exposure, and that the WiFi/Bluetooth connection is working as expected. This catches mounting angle issues or settings mistakes before you’ve committed to a multi-week unattended deployment.

No-Glow Infrared Advantage
The T85’s 36-piece no-glow infrared array is invisible to both animals and passersby, unlike low-glow alternatives that emit a faint visible red light during night captures. For hunting scouting specifically, this matters since visible IR glow can alert wary game to the camera’s presence over repeated exposures, potentially altering their behavior around that specific location.
